DEVELOPMENT OF STUDENT DISCIPLINE CHARACTER EDUCATION THROUGH CEREMONY ACTIVITIES AT BUMIREJO STATE ELEMENTARY SCHOOL

Abstract

The purpose of this study was 1) to know the concept of conducting ceremonial activities in Bumirejo State Elementary School 5 and 2) to describe the ceremonial activities in developing the discipline character of students. The method used in this study is descriptive-qualitative method with interviews, observation, and documentation that aims to get a general understanding of social conditions from the perspective of participants (Rahmat, 2009). The results of this study are 1) the concept of conducting ceremonial activities in Bumirejo State Elementary School 5 and 2) can describe the ceremonial activities in developing the discipline character of students. So, the conclusion of this study is that the ceremonial activities can develop the discipline character of students in Bumirejo State Elementary School 5.
